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long does it take to receive my brand-new motorist's license?The processing time for a replacement can differ. Generally, the short-term license is issued immediately, while the permanent replacement might take anywhere from 2 to 6 weeks. 2. Can I drive with a short-term license?Yes, you can drive with the temporary license while waiting for your new one. 3. What if I find my lost license after applying for a replacement?If you find your lost license after getting a replacement, you are required to return it to your local authority right away and inform them of the circumstance. 4. Is there a way to get an emergency situation replacement?In some cases, local authorities might use an expedited service for an extra fee. It's best to ask about this option at your regional authority. 5. Can I change my chauffeur's license if I am not currently in Belgium?If you are temporarily outdoors Belgium, contact the closest Belgian embassy or consulate for guidance on how to obtain a replacement license.
